> These are the DL&W cars, built by ACF with the PRR order featured in the
model.
> The development of the kit was related to an article to appear in the new
> Railway Prototype Cyclopedia, a link to which I circulated a few weeks
ago, to
> which I contributed DL&W photos -- no idea which they've used. But the
article
> will point out any differences between the PRR and DL&W versions.  
I did drop
> Tangent a note asking if they were going to offer a DL&W version, as I
thought
> they were going to. These were all delivered with the "Road of..."
rectangle in
> the second panel from the right. A DL&W hopper car decal set will get
the model
> > lettered.
> >
> > Should be a nice kit, and the freight car purists are raving about it
thus far.

> > The newest model from Tangent looks like it would be correct for DL&W
> > gons in the 68500 to 68999 class built by ACF in September and October
> > 1951. Am I correct about this? See photos of the model at
> > http://tangentscalemodels.com/acf70tongondolareplicas.aspx. Does anyone
> > have prototype photos of these cars in service or know of an
appropriate
> > decal set? If you have seen this model or have additional info on it or
> > the prototype I would like to know your thoughts.
